Igrew up in a household where the Valentine's chocolates were more likely to be homemade fudge than fancy boxed bonbons. Particularly when there was a snowy day in early February and schools were closed, we would get out the enameled Dutch oven and wooden spoons and turn to the fudge recipes in my mother's dog-eared Modern Encyclopedia of Cooking.

Fudgemaking provided pleasant winter entertainment and -- when we children could bear to part with what we'd produced -- fine Valentine's Day presents. (One of my strategies was to give fudge only to my grandmother and other relatives who would share.)

When we were very young, my mother cooked the fudge herself -- the sugar mixture gets too hot for small children to safely handle. At about age 11, I took over the cooking job, though I still needed her help in judging when the fudge was done. Eventually, I learned to listen for the distinct snapping sound of the bubbling mixture as it boiled down and neared doneness. And I learned to "test for the soft ball stage" by dropping a bit of the mixture into ice water, then squeezing it between my fingers to check for the right consistency (see sidebar on Page F5 for tips on testing with and without a candy thermometer).

For a fudge to "set up" -- become firm -- beating with a wooden spoon or a standing mixer is required. When we were growing up, it was a communal activity. Nobody minded taking several turns with the spoon during the 15 or so minutes required, perhaps because of the enticing aroma that came from the pot with every swipe.

When did this American favorite come into being? According to "Oh Fudge!" by Lee Edwards Benning (Holt, 1993), the first known mention of the candy is in a file in the Vassar College archives. A Miss Emelyn Hartridge, who graduated from Vassar in the early 1890s, wrote that in 1886 she had obtained a fudge recipe in Baltimore. She recalled that fudge was sold there for 40 cents a pound by a grocery store "at 279 Williams Street." She added that she made 30 pounds for the Vassar senior auction in 1888 and believed that this was its first "real introduction to the college."

In 1894, a student at another women's college, Wellesley, mentioned concocting a make-do, dorm-dwellers' version of fudge cooked over a chimney lamp!

In doing my own research on fudge, I've discovered it made its way into cookbooks near the end of the 19th century. Recipes for two fudges and two "panocha" (brown sugar fudge, now more often spelled penuche) appear in "Mrs. Rorer's New Cook Book," published in Philadelphia in 1898. Eleven years later, fudge recipes showed up on the other side of the United States in "The 1909 Tried and True Recipes of Prineville [Oregon] Ladies."

Several decades later, fudge had become such a standard in the American home repertoire that "The Joy of Cooking" advised: "The fudge pot is responsible for the beginnings of many a good cook. So be tolerant when, some rainy day, your children take an interest in the sweeter side of kitchen life." (Actually, fudge and many other candies set up better in dry weather, but it's possible to compensate on humid days by cooking to a degree or so higher than normal.)

Like caramels, early fudges were prepared by boiling sugar, milk (or cream) and butter to the soft ball stage and, like fondants, they were finished by beating or scraping on a marble slab until the candy "grained" finely and set up.

Later, "no-beat" fudges that contained marshmallow creme or marshmallows and that set up quickly without stirring came on the scene. The taste of these is often as rich and mellow as the old-fashioned recipes, but the texture is coarser and sometimes even grainy. More recently, super-quick mock fudges that call for sweetened condensed milk and that skip both the boiling down and the beating have arrived. These can be smooth and quite tasty (especially to those who haven't had the real thing!), but since the key step, boiling down, is omitted, they lack the wonderful underlying caramel taste that is the hallmark of true fudge.

Following are recipes that require both boiling and beating, as well as a more modern no-beat version. Any of the choices would make appealing Valentine gifts.

For convenience, they can be prepared ahead, wrapped airtight and frozen for up to a month. If you have a heavy-duty standing mixer such as a KitchenAid, you can greatly minimize the effort required to make classic fudge by beating it on low speed. (The motors of some lightweight standing mixers and hand-held models aren't strong enough.)

Classic Beaten Chocolate Fudge

(Makes about 2 pounds)

This is reminiscent of early fudge, although not quite traditional since it uses vanilla, nuts and corn syrup. The candy cooks down slowly so it develops a full, rich caramel flavor. The final result is smooth, chocolaty and, in my mind, tastes just the way fudge should.

The corn syrup reduces graininess, lends a slightly chewy texture and makes it possible to start beating before the mixture is completely cool yet end up with a smooth product.

4 1/2 ounces unsweetened chocolate, chopped

1 3/4 cups heavy (whipping) cream

2 cups granulated sugar

1/2 cup light corn syrup

1 tablespoon unsalted butter, slightly softened

1/8 teaspoon salt

2 1/2 teaspoons vanilla extract

1 cup (about 4 ounces) chopped walnuts or pecans (optional)

Line an 8-inch square baking pan with aluminum foil, allowing the foil to hang over 2 sides of the pan by several inches.

Place the chocolate in a large bowl (if using a standing mixer, use the mixer bowl). Set aside.

In a 3- to 4-quart heavy nonreactive pot over medium-high heat, combine the cream, sugar, corn syrup, butter and salt. Stirring frequently with a long-handled wooden spoon, bring the mixture to a boil. Immediately cover the pot and boil for 3 minutes to allow the steam to wash down any sugar crystals from the inside of the pot (the crystals might otherwise result in a grainy consistency).

Meanwhile, wash and dry the spoon.

Uncover the pot and reduce the heat so the mixture bubbles briskly but is not at a hard boil. If any sugar crystals remain on the side of the pot, use a damp cloth to carefully remove them. Cook, stirring to scrape the bottom of the pot frequently, 12 to 15 minutes, until the mixture registers 237 to 238 degrees on a candy thermometer. (The tip of the thermometer should be under the surface of the mixture but should not touch the bottom of the pot.) Alternatively, to test using the cold water method, drop a bit of the mixture into a cup of ice water and cool for 10 seconds. If the mixture forms a slightly firm ball that flattens when squeezed, it is done.

Immediately remove the pot from the heat. Pour the mixture over the chocolate, being sure to shake, not scrape, the mixture from the pot. Set aside to cool for 10 to 12 minutes. (This prevents a grainy consistency.)

Using the clean wooden spoon or a standing mixer on low speed, stir or beat the mixture until the chocolate is completely melted and incorporated. Add the vanilla and stir vigorously or beat on low speed until the mixture begins to thicken and loses some of its shine, 12 to 15 minutes. (If at any point the mixture appears to be separated and oily, add a few teaspoons of warm water and mix until smooth again.) When the fudge has stiffened but is not completely "set up" or firm, add the nuts, if desired, and mix until blended. Quickly scrape the fudge into the prepared pan. Using a lightly buttered table knife, spread and smooth the surface. Transfer the pan to a wire rack and set aside to cool completely, about 2 hours. Refrigerate until chilled and firm, about 2 hours.

Using the foil edges as handles, carefully remove the fudge from the pan in 1 piece. Remove and discard the foil; transfer the fudge to a cutting board. Using a sharp knife, cut the fudge into pieces. If desired, trim the uneven edges. If stacking the fudge, be careful to place wax or parchment paper between layers. To store, refrigerate the fudge in an airtight container.

Old-Fashioned Beaten Penuche

(Makes about 2 1/4 pounds fudge)

This fudge boasts a chewy yet smooth consistency and a distinct brown sugar flavor. In Mexico "penuche" (puh-NOO-chee) or panocha or penuchi is the word used for "raw sugar" or "coarse sugar."

Unlike most classic fudges, which need to cool down after cooking, this one is beaten hot.

2 cups light brown sugar

1 cup granulated sugar

1 cup heavy (whipping) cream

2/3 cup dark corn syrup

3 tablespoons unsalted butter, cut into pieces

Pinch of salt

1 teaspoon vanilla extract

1 cup (4 ounces) chopped pecans or walnuts (optional)

Line an 8-inch square baking pan with aluminum foil, allowing the foil to hang over 2 sides of the pan by several inches.

In a 3- to 4-quart heavy nonreactive pot over medium-high heat, combine the brown and granulated sugars, cream, corn syrup, butter and salt. Stirring frequently with a long-handled wooden spoon, bring the mixture to a boil. Immediately cover the pot and boil for 3 minutes to allow the steam to wash down any sugar crystals from the inside of the pot (the crystals might otherwise result in a grainy consistency).

Meanwhile, wash and dry the spoon.

Uncover the pot and reduce the heat so the mixture bubbles briskly but is not at a hard boil. If any sugar crystals remain on the side of the pot, use a damp cloth to carefully remove them. Cook, stirring to scrape the bottom of the pan frequently, for 2 to 4 minutes, until the mixture bubbles loudly and registers 238 to 239 degrees on a candy thermometer. (The tip of the thermometer should be under the surface of the mixture but should not touch the bottom of the pot.) Alternatively, to test using the cold water method, drop a bit of the mixture into a cup of ice water and cool for 10 seconds. If the mixture forms a slightly firm ball that flattens when squeezed, it is done.

Immediately remove the pot from the heat. Quickly pour the mixture into a large bowl, being sure to shake, not scrape, the mixture from the pot. Immediately stir the fudge with the wooden spoon or beat on low speed with an electric mixer. The mixture should seem runny at first. Continue to stir vigorously or beat on low speed until the mixture begins to thicken slightly and loses some of its shine, 18 to 22 minutes. When the mixture has stiffened but is not completely set, stir in the vanilla and, if desired, nuts and mix until blended. Quickly scrape the mixture into the prepared pan; it will still be slightly fluid and very warm, even hot to the touch. Do not smooth the surface with a knife; instead, shake the pan quickly or rap the bottom of the pan on the counter to even the surface. Transfer the pan to a wire rack to cool completely, about 2 hours. Refrigerate until chilled and firm, about 2 hours.

Using the foil edges as handles, carefully remove the fudge from the pan in 1 piece. Remove and discard the foil; transfer the fudge to a cutting board. Using a sharp knife, cut the fudge into pieces. If desired, trim the uneven edges. If stacking the fudge, be careful to place wax or parchment paper between layers. To store, refrigerate the fudge in an airtight container.

Peanut Butter-Peanut Fudge

(Makes about 2 pounds)

This no-beat fudge is slightly soft, sweet and has a pleasing peanut taste.

While the fudge is cooking, stir the mixture frequently and watch it carefully to avoid scorching. The peanut butter tends to thin out the fudge a bit; it's better to err on the side of overcooking rather than undercooking.

2 1/2 cups granulated sugar

3/4 cup evaporated milk (do not use low-fat versions)

1/3 cup dark corn syrup

3 tablespoons unsalted butter, cut into pieces

3/4 cup marshmallow creme

1/4 cup creamy peanut butter

1 teaspoon vanilla extract

1 1/2 cups (6 ounces) chopped unsalted peanuts (optional)

Line an 8-inch square baking pan with aluminum foil, allowing the foil to hang over 2 sides of the pan by several inches.

In a 3- to 4-quart heavy nonreactive pot over medium-high heat, combine the sugar, milk, corn syrup and butter. Stirring constantly with a long-handled wooden spoon, bring the mixture to a boil. Immediately cover the pot and boil for 3 minutes to allow the steam to wash down any sugar crystals from the side of the pot (the crystals might otherwise result in a grainy consistency).

Meanwhile, wash and dry the spoon.

Uncover the pot and reduce the heat so the mixture bubbles briskly but not at a hard boil. (If any sugar crystals remain on pan side, use a damp cloth to carefully remove them.) Cook, stirring and scraping the bottom of the pan frequently, for at least 4 to 5 minutes, until the mixture bubbles loudly and registers 241 to 242 degrees on a candy thermometer. Alternatively, to test using the cold water method, drop a bit of the mixture into a cup of ice water and cool for 10 seconds. If the mixture forms a slightly firm ball that flattens when squeezed, it is done.

Immediately remove the pot from the heat. Add the marshmallow creme, peanut butter, vanilla and peanuts, if using, and mix just until combined. Quickly pour the fudge into the prepared pan, being sure to shake the fudge, not scrape it. Do not smooth the surface with a knife; instead, shake the pan quickly or rap the bottom of the pan on the counter. Transfer the pan to a wire rack to cool completely, about 2 hours. Refrigerate until chilled and firm, about 2 hours.

Using the foil edges as handles, carefully remove the fudge from the pan in 1 piece. Remove and discard the foil. Transfer the fudge to a cutting board. Using a sharp knife, cut the fudge into pieces. If desired, trim the uneven edges. If stacking the fudge, be careful to place wax or parchment paper between layers. To store, refrigerate the fudge in an airtight container.

What should fudge look like after beating? ›

The fudge is then beaten as this makes the fudge slightly crumbly rather than chewy. Beating the mixture encourages the formation of small sugar crystals, which leads to the crumbly texture. The crystals may not be noticeable in themselves but the fudge mixture will thicken and turn from shiny to matte in appearance.

What is the secret to smooth fudge that is not gritty? ›

Once a seed crystal forms, it grows bigger and bigger as the fudge cools. A lot of big crystals in fudge makes it grainy. By letting the fudge cool without stirring, you avoid creating seed crystals.

Why do you add cream of tartar to fudge? ›

Cream of tartar is used in caramel sauces and fudge to help prevent the sugar from crystallizing while cooking. It also prevents cooling sugars from forming brittle crystals, this is why it's the secret ingredient in snickerdoodles!
